Clearing path for Mac gas

Deh Cho ponder offer; decision in spring; Dene Tha get federal consultation officer

Gary Park

For Petroleum News

There are signs of action to move two stumbling blocks standing in the path of the Mackenzie Gas Project. A decision is likely this spring by the Deh Cho First Nations on whether they will accept the Canadian government’s latest land claim offer, while the government has named a chief consultation o....
